So what makes the One Touch different from the Fizzi? Both placing the carbonating cylinder and the water bottle require that you follow the specific very same treatment similar to the Fizzi, and this device likewise just takes 1 L-sized bottles. The One Touch requires electricity to operate since it boasts 3 buttons, each preset for different levels of carbonation (sodastream instructions).
The second setting is the median 10-second burst that the majority of people will stick to typically. It delivers a carbonated drink virtually similar to the one produced by the Fizzi or other soda makers. The third and last button provides a higher level of carbonation by shooting for about 15 seconds prior to ceasing.
Essentially, the One Touch offers greater pre-programmed levels of soda customization for a somewhat higher asking rate. It has an elegant visual with an extremely simple to use push-in snap-lock system that makes it a breeze to insert your next water bottle when it's ready for carbonation. Just press the bottle up into the receiving nozzle and you'll hear it snap into location. This soda maker design doesn't use up too much room on the cooking area counter and doesn't require electrical power or batteries to work.
It likewise utilizes the signature push-to-carbonate button at the top of the maker that we have come to get out of a lot of Soda, Stream designs. Straight above the slot where your water bottle will go is a series of 3 water droplet icons. These icons show the present level of carbonation you are infusing into your water bottle based upon your pressure and the time you've held the button down.
s are helpful since it can be difficult to tell how much carbonation you puzzled into your water bottle with the other models that use the very same button system. State that you forgot the length of time you held the button down; now you have to drink the water bottle yourself to determine how bubbly it is before you can continue or stop carbonation.
